## Tracing Requests Across Services

All services at Verdanto propagate a `trace-ref` header, generated at the Ostrel gateway. If a customer reports a slow checkout, grab the trace-ref from the gateway logs and paste it into Spanline, our trace viewer. Spanline stitches spans from cart, pricing, and fulfillment automatically. If a span is missing, the owning service is probably dropping the header — file it against that team. To query Spanline's API directly from the CLI, authenticate with the key below.

service key, tadup-tahog: zpat7_wB1tnEL

Ticket: Staging env misconfigured for Siftgate bloom filter

The bloom layer in front of the Pellet KV store is rejecting all lookups in staging because the env file was copied from the dev template without credentials. False-positive tuning values are fine; only the auth line is missing. To unblock the weekly demo, the Pellet admission secret must be set on the following line.

env line for yaguf-fajop: LEDGER_TOKEN13=fb08984397349

# Pindrop Service — Environments

Quick note for reviewers poking at our container setup. We slimmed the Pindrop images hard last sprint: dropped the full base distro, moved to a distroless runtime layer, and stripped debug tooling from staging and prod builds. Dev images keep a shell for convenience, which is why they're bigger — don't panic. Image scanning runs on every push, and the slimming cut our CVE surface roughly in half. The per-environment runtime settings currently in effect are shown below.

config for tawif-bagef:
[sorwyn]
team = sorys
access_code = ac_9ba40c
host = sorwyn.ordingrid.local
port = 5000
owner = aldok.quenion
peer = belath.paliqcloud.local

Subject: Canary gating — new owner

Hey! Quick heads-up before the next release train: we're reshuffling who signs off on canary deploy gating rules for Larkspur. Error-budget thresholds, rollback triggers, the bake-time windows — all of that now sits with one person instead of the rotating duty. Should make your life easier, since there's a single name to ping when a gate looks stuck. Effective Monday, the responsible owner is:

signatory, kafop-bahaf: Lamion Queniel Jorir Olidor